Wrestler Yianni Kioussis The "Asperger Dynamo"
We welcome the awesome and inspiring Yianni Kioussis to the show! "Asperger Dynamo" is the wrestling persona of Yianni, who has Asperger's Syndrome. Yianni uses the name to represent his wrestling persona, which embodies the underdog and aims to inspire those with disabilities. He embraces his social difficulties, such as a lack of filter and social cue issues, as part of his wrestling character, finding the ring a place where he can express himself authentically. Join us!

Actor / Writer / Producer Peter Nikkos
We welcome the super cool Peter Nikkos to the show! Peter currently resides in Los Angeles with his lovely wife, RID Certified American Sign Language (ASL) Interpreter, Eva Tingley. Born in the small village of Karyes, near Sparta, Greece, he immigrated with family to Chicago and was educated in the Windy City's public school system attending Lane Technical High School and James Monroe Elementary School. The first in a family of five to graduate from college, he earned a Bachelor of Arts degree from North Park University while receiving professional consideration following an exemplary college soccer career. Strong theatre, improv and on-camera training brought him to the west coast, where significant onscreen work includes DESERT DAWN (Al Bravo Films), RUTHLESS (Premiere), FIRE BORN (Independent), BLACK WARRANT (Premiere), BLOWBACK (Premiere), ENCOUNTER (Amazon), AMERICAN CRIME STORY: VERSACE (FX), THE LAST SHIP (TNT) and TIME TRAVELING BONG (Comedy Central).
